The Use of a Single-Cylinder, Medium-Speed Diesel Research Engine for Railway Diesel Fuel Additive Evaluations

This paper focuses on discussions on why and how to use a test facility, which is centered around a single-cylinder four-stroke medium-speed diesel research engine, for conducting railway diesel fuel additive evaluations. By using the facility, repeated evaluation runs for a fuel additive were carried out. Results from the runs show similar trends on brake specific fuel consumption (BSFC) and emissions changes. In addition, they appear to agree well with those reported from RP-503 test for the same fuel additive. The test facility and procedure proved to be efficient and cost-effective for the evaluations.
